Description:
The property is available for immediate occupancy and is situated on a site that is adjacent to two roads. Transfer of ownership will occur after the registration of inheritance. The roof has a leak, and the property includes a warehouse and a storehouse. The area is classified as a flood zone with a maximum inundation depth of 3 to 5 meters. A separate contract is required for CATV services. A portion of the land is identified as uncertain property.

About Chuo City
Chuo City is located in the heart of Yamanashi Prefecture, known for its fruit orchards, particularly grapes and peaches. The area is surrounded by natural beauty, including mountains and rivers, making it attractive for outdoor enthusiasts. Chuo City has a rich history, with several cultural landmarks and traditional festivals. It is close to the Fuji Five Lakes region, a popular destination for sightseeing.
